**Action item: Upgrade Hollowpipe broker to 4.x (owner: on-call)**

The outage boiled down to the 3.7 broker dropping acks under memory pressure, which 4.x fixes. We've scheduled the rolling upgrade for next week, but on-call should be ready to pause consumers per-queue if lag spikes. Heads up: the `fanout-orders` exchange needs a config migration first. Step-by-step upgrade and rollback instructions are written up on the internal page.

dashboard of kafof-tahaf = https://confluence.tolvaqsys.internal/projects/browse/display/a1250987

## Releases

The `stringsweep` script extracts translation strings from the Pellingford app before each release. Run it from the repo root; it scans templates and source files, writes a fresh catalog to `locale/out`, and fails if any string lacks a context comment. Cutting a release means bumping the version in `sweep.toml`, running the full extraction, and committing the catalog. The release tarball is then built by CI and must be signed before the translators' portal accepts it; signing uses the key below.

release key, hadug-kawef: bky13_mPGeFZeR1GZ1G

## Environment Variables & Wiki Roles

Welcome aboard! Our internal wiki, Fernpad, gates page edits by role, and the sync service reads those roles from environment variables. Most of them are boring: FERNPAD_ROLE_SOURCE, FERNPAD_ADMIN_GROUP, and so on. Contractors get the "drafter" role by default, so don't panic if a save button is greyed out. One variable is sensitive, though — it's the token Fernpad uses to verify role claims. Add it on the next line.

sealed setting: VAULT_KEY20=c8ea1e419912889df6b4

This page documents the environment layout referenced in the Cadentry stale-cache postmortem. The bug occurred because staging and production shared a cache key prefix, so a staging deploy warmed entries that production then served for roughly forty minutes. Prefixes are now namespaced per environment and TTLs were shortened on the edge tier. On-call: if you see cross-environment cache hits in the dashboard, treat it as a regression of this incident and page the platform lead. The corrected production cache settings are recorded below.

service settings:
PRAIX_LOG_LEVEL=error
PRAIX_METRICS_HOST=metrics.praix.qorvelcorp.corp
PRAIX_POOL_SIZE=16